What is the CPQ approach?
A CPQ (configure, price, quote) strategy is a comprehensive approach companies with complex product configurations, variable pricing, and bespoke customer requirements take to streamline and optimize the sales process.
-
What does CPQ stand for?
CPQ stands for Configure, Price, Quote. The abbreviation describes a process chain in sales: product configuration, price calculation and quote generation.

How much is Salesforce CPQ complex?
Salesforce CPQ offers plenty of options to set up your pricing structure. Determine whether a product has a recurring fee, a one-time fee or a combination of both. Choose whether the price is based on a price book entry or change your pricing method to cost-and-markup pricing, block pricing or percent-of-total pricing.

What is the CPQ sales process?
CPQ centralizes and automates customer data, product pricing and discounting, contract renewals, and business rules; it makes product data available in real time so sales reps have everything at their fingertips to respond quickly to customer needs.
-
What is the difference between CRM and CPQ?
Configure, Price, Quote (CPQ) is a smart sales tool to generate quotes for orders of products/services quickly and precisely. Customer relationship management (CRM) is a sales software to ease business communication and boost sales efficiency.
